
On Wednesday afternoon, police in Esch-sur-Alzette arrested a man for disorderly behaviour on Avenue de la Gare. The man, who was said to be heavily intoxicated, had attacked a person outside a café, although the latter escaped unscathed. The drunken man continued to fight even when police arrived, so he was taken to a cell to sober up after a doctor's check-up. The police report stated the man showed aggression towards both medical staff and officers, spitting at one of the latter.
On Wednesday evening a woman was attacked by a man on Rue du Commerce in Luxembourg City, shortly before 11pm. The attacker grabbed her by the neck and hit her in the face. The woman's partner intervened, hitting the attacker over the head with a glass bottle. The perpetrator then fled with a bloody head wound towards the station where he approached police. Both the assault victim and her partner also reported the incident. All three had been drinking prior to the assault, although the attacker later resisted medical treatment and behaved aggressively towards police. He was taken into custody for the night as a result. Both men involved will be prosecuted for the exchange of blows.
Finally, a man was assaulted shortly before midnight in the Gare district, after a group of people hit him with fists and an iron bar. They fled with the victim's valuables, including his mobile phone. Police have opened an investigation after they were unable to locate the perpetrators immediately following the incident.
